    heres what i found that i thought were cool
    AYASHE: Cheyenne name meaning "little one."
    CHU'SI: Hopi name meaning "snake flower."
    ISTAS: "snow."
    KIMI: Algonquin name meaning "secret."
    LEOTIE: Possibly a new creation; may mean "prairie flower."
    MAKA: Sioux name meaning "earth."
    MANSI: Hopi name meaning "plucked flower."
    MIGISI: Cheyenne name meaning "eagle."
    MEOQUANEE: Cheyenne name meaning "wears red."
    NADIE: Algonquin name meaning "wise."
    PATI: Miwok name meaning "break by twisting."
    SANUYE: Miwok name meaning "red cloud at sundown."
    SISIKA: "bird"
    TALA: "wolf"
    WEEKO: Sioux name meaning "pretty."
    YOKI: Hopi name meaning "rain."
    ZITKALA: Dakota name meaning "bird."

    Elizabeth. Also of Hebrew origin, this elegant moniker means ‘God’s promise’. Since the reign of Queen Elizabeth I, Elizabeth has become one of the most frequently used names in the world. It has dozens of variants and short forms, including Beth, Betty, Betsy, Elspeth, Elisa, Elsa, Liz and Libby. Famous modern day bearers of the name include the British queen Elizabeth II and actress Elizabeth Taylor.
